Players apologize after N-word used during UBA basketball spat

National Taiwan Normal University (NTNU) basketball team players have apologized after one of their team members used a racial slur against a Senegalese-Taiwanese player during a University Basketball Association (UBA) game on Saturday, February 27. Cop who shot unarmed foreigner dead claims in defense: Couldn’t see blood for dark skin

A police officer who shot a naked, unarmed man dead in Hsinchu County two years ago pleaded in his defense yesterday that he did not notice the first four shots he fired at close range had penetrated the victim, because the man was “dark skinned”. The defendant’s statement in court was greeted by shudders, as the case already tainted by allegations of racism, unfolded in yesterday’s trial.
